| Canonical Smiles | C=CCNC1=CC=CC=C1 |
| IUPAC Name | N-prop-2-enylaniline |
| InChIKey | LQFLWKPCQITJIH-UHFFFAOYSA-N |
| INCHI | 1S/C9H11N/c1-2-8-10-9-6-4-3-5-7-9/h2-7,10H,1,8H2 |
| Isomeric SMILES | C=CCNC1=CC=CC=C1 |
| Molecular Weight | 133.19 |

| Description | This compound belongs to the class of organic compounds known as phenylalkylamines. These are organic amines where the amine group is secondary and linked on one end to a phenyl group and on the other end, to an alkyl group. |

| Solubility | Insoluble in water. |
|---|---|
| Refractive Index | 1.56 |
| Flash Point(°F) | 89°C(lit.) |
| Flash Point(°C) | 89°C(lit.) |
| Boil Point(°C) | 220 °C |
